1. Preventative Care
1. Preventative Care
Bringing your pet in for an annual diagnostic and wellness exam can help reassure you that your dog
or cat is healthy or help us detect hidden diseases or conditions early. Early detection can improve
the prognosis of many diseases, keep medical costs down, and help your pet live longer. Many dogs
and cats are good at hiding signs that something is wrong, so subtle changes in their health or
behavior might be easy to overlook. And, depending on the disease, some pets don’t show any
symptoms. Dogs and cats age far quicker than humans, so it is even more crucial for our companion
animals to receive regular exams. In addition, the risks of arthritis, cancer, diabetes, heart disease,
hormone disorders, and kidney and liver problems all increase with age.

During your pet’s wellness exam, we will perform a physical assessment, checking your dog or cat
from nose to tail. We will also make sure your pet receives appropriate vaccinations and preventives.
We will perform a diagnostic workup, which may include blood, fecal, and urine tests to check for
parasites and underlying diseases. We may also recommend that your pet receive dental care. When
your pet is nearing his or her senior years, we will recommend a baseline exam and diagnostic
workup so we’ll know what’s normal for your pet. This will enable us to keep track of any changes.
When you come in, we will also discuss heartworms, fleas, ticks, and other internal and external
parasites. These are much more than just pests; they can cause life-threatening conditions in your pet and cause severe health problems for you and your family. We will recommend the best preventives for your pet, based on lifestyle and risk factors. We can also provide advice on keeping your whole household safe from parasitic infection.

3. Wellness Plans
3. Wellness Plans
One of the best things you can do for your pet is to keep him or her healthy. The easiest and least
expensive ways to do that is by bringing in your pet for regular exams and vaccinations. Dogs and
cats age faster than people, so changes in your pet’s health can happen in a short time. Wellness
programs allow us to diagnose diseases and conditions early, when they’re easier to treat or manage.
Often, we can help prevent diseases entirely, just by ensuring that your pet has received appropriate
vaccinations and preventives. Healthy adult dogs and cats should visit us once a year. Puppies,
kittens, senior pets, and pets with health issues or illnesses need more frequent checkups.
